什么是DNS服务器?一篇文章带你全面了解
一、引言
随着互联网技术的飞速发展,我们每天都在与各种各样的网络概念打交道。
其中,DNS服务器无疑是互联网基础设施中不可或缺的一环。
那么,什么是DNS服务器?它在互联网中扮演着怎样的角色?本文将带你全面了解DNS服务器的基本概念、作用、工作原理以及常见应用。
二、DNS服务器的基本概念
DNS,即域名系统(Domain Name System),是互联网中用于将域名转换为IP地址的分布式数据库系统。
DNS服务器则是负责存储、查询和更新DNS数据库信息的服务器。
简单来说,DNS服务器就像一个电话簿,帮助我们查找互联网上的域名和对应的IP地址。
三、DNS服务器的作用
1. 域名解析:DNS服务器的主要作用是将域名(如www.example.com)转换为IP地址(如XXX.XXX.XXX.XXX),以便用户能够访问目标网站或应用。
2. 服务定位:除了域名解析,DNS服务器还能协助定位其他网络服务,如邮件服务器、FTP服务器等。
3. 负载均衡:通过DNS服务器的智能配置,可以实现网络流量的负载均衡,提高网站的访问速度和稳定性。
4. 缓存机制:DNS服务器具有缓存功能,可以存储最近查询过的域名和IP地址的映射关系,提高查询速度。
四、DNS服务器的工作原理
1. 客户端发起域名查询请求时,首先会查询本地DNS缓存,若缓存中有相关记录,则直接返回结果。
2. 若本地DNS缓存未找到相关记录,客户端会向默认DNS服务器(通常是本地ISP的DNS服务器)发起查询请求。
3. 默认DNS服务器收到请求后,会在其根域名数据库中查询目标域名的权威DNS服务器地址,并返回给客户端。
4. 客户端向权威DNS服务器发起查询请求,权威DNS服务器返回目标域名对应的IP地址。
5. 客户端获取IP地址后,即可通过该IP地址访问目标网站或服务。同时,为了提高查询效率,客户端和DNS服务器会将查询结果缓存起来,供后续查询使用。
五、DNS服务器的常见应用
1. 域名注册与管理:通过DNS服务器,用户可以注册和管理自己的域名,建立个人或企业的网站。
2. 邮件服务:通过DNS服务器的邮件服务定位功能,用户可以轻松配置邮件服务器,收发邮件更加便捷。
3. 网站负载均衡:通过智能DNS服务器的负载均衡功能,可以实现网站流量的分配,提高网站的访问速度和稳定性。
4. 应用服务部署:DNS服务器可以帮助用户部署各种互联网应用服务,如FTP、VPN等。
5. 安全防护:通过DNS服务器的安全配置,可以有效防范域名劫持、DDoS攻击等网络安全风险。
六、结论
DNS服务器是互联网基础设施中不可或缺的一环,它承担着域名解析、服务定位、负载均衡等重要任务。
通过本文的讲解,相信读者对DNS服务器已经有了全面的了解。
在实际应用中,我们需要根据具体需求合理配置和使用DNS服务器,以便更好地发挥其在互联网中的作用。
电脑连上wifi但上不了网怎么回事?
原因是DNS服务器的ip地址出错,修改一下即可。
1、打开电脑桌面,如图所示,点击WIFI图标选择打开网络偏好设置进入。
2、进入页面,如图所示,点击右下角的高级。
3、切换至DNS页,如图所示,点击左下角的+按钮进入。
4、然后就是出来的页面中,需要输入114.114.144.144通用的DNS。
5、最后,将页面的114.114.114.114DNS地址拖至第一位即可,这样设置好以后就可以解决问题了。
有没有觉得 dnspod 越来越差了
DNSbed这个免费DNS服务部落已经关注了好久了,之前一直没有机会来好好介绍一下它。 DNSpod是国内最火的第三方免费DNS服务,我居然看到不少用万网、阿里云主机的也抛弃了自带的NS,用上了DNSpod免费DNS服务器。 但是细想一下,又觉得不对劲,因为国内做得好叫得出名的免费DNS服务貌似只有DNSPOD,虽然DNSPOD已经收归了腾讯旗下,但是凡事总得有个万一,守株待兔不能只守一颗树,最起码要两颗树吧。 当我看到DNSbed出来后本以为DNSbed会成为DNSpod的竞争对手,没有想到一年过后DNSbed的DNS服务没有什么变化,反而衰落了,而DNSpod的IP服务已经开始大范围推广了,两个DNS服务出现了走向两极的发展趋势。 据DNSbed上讲DNSbed是广州鼎通计算机科技有限的旗下产品,但是上次在站长看到一篇专访文章讲的就是草根站长DNSbed创业的故事,看来大家都是从草根走出来的,只是有些草根很幸运,像DNSpod这样的已经由草根变成了企业了。 DNS经常会出现一些莫名的问题导致打不开,这里有:1、无法打开:访问不了?排查DNS解析问题附域名解析的基本原理2、经典的NS问题:国外注册域名和空间因NS问题导致无法访问解决办法以Godaddy为例3、国外免费DNS:he可添加25个域名的免费DNS服务DNSbed国内云端免费DNS提供商与DNSpod免费DNS服务对比一、DNSbed国内免费DNS服务申请使用1、DNSbed:官方首页:2、进入后,先点击注册,填写你的个人基本信息,注册一个账3、然后是添加你想使用DNSbed的域名。 4、接下来就是更改NS了,以我在Godaddy注册的域名为例,先进入域名管理面板。 5、然后在页面下方找到&lduo;Set NameServes&rduo;,点击它。 6、最后就是填入DNSbed的四个NS,等待生效即可。 二、DNSbed与DNSpod比较一:NS服务器一国外一国内1、用Ping查了一下DNSbed的NS服务器,IP居然是美国加拿大那边的。 2、而DNSpod的NS服务器全部在国内,且都是自己的服务器,采用了CDN加速。 3、NS服务器一个放在国外,一个放在国内,国内用户的DNS访问解析时间自然就会大不同了。 4、如果你的是放在国内的,当然是希望用户访问时的DNS解析时间能够越短越好了。 三、DNSbed与DNSpod比较二:服务器响应速度一慢一快1、上面已经探测到了DNSbed的服务器没有在国内,所以响应时间也就稍微长了点了。 2、而DNSpod由于服务器放在国内,且加上CDN服务,响应时间比较短。 四、DNSbed与DNSpod比较三:免费用户限制一多一少1、DNSbed对于免费用户居然只能添加5个域名,且还对域名记录数、TTL进行了相关的限制。 2、相反DNSpod则对上都不做限制,只是免费版本的DNSpod与付费版本的DNSpod使用的不同的NS服务器。 五、DNSbed与DNSpod比较四:技术支持一差—好1、从目前来看,DNSbed如果有问题的话似乎只能到官方得到解答,况且貌似没有人打理,里面基本上是废品信息。 2、DNSpod除了外,还有、微博等多种方式,如果你是IP客户,可以享受的服务就更多了。 六、DNSbed免费DNS服务使用小结1、实际上测试我们常用的免费版本的DNSpod的NS服务器响应时间还有大于的,尤其是响应时间基本上在以上。 2、对比了一下DNSpod的IP套餐用的NS服务器响应时间,发现基本上在50以下。 看来这免费的DNSpod和付费的DNSpod还是有区别的。 3、DNSbed这个免费DNS不知道是不是站长忙于基它的事情了,还是没有资金继续投入,总之给我感觉就是DNSbed一路走来很不容易,前途不明朗。 文章出自:免费资源部落 版权所有。 本站文章除注明出处外,皆为作者原创文章,可引用,但请注明来源。
追加200 求计算机网络课程设计
设计1:XX网络构建方案设计设计2:企业内部Web站点构建及维护;设计3:企业内部的DNS服务器构建。 设计4:利用双网卡主机实现路由功能首先保证主机有两块网卡,一块连接你的“猫”,一块连接副机,然后进入到副机电脑的Windows XP的“网络邻居”中,点选“设置家庭或小型办公网络”,这时要确定主机电脑和副机已连接好,点两下“下一步”,会出现三个选项,选择第二项,继续点“下一步”,在“工作组名”栏里把默认的“MSHOME”改为“WORKGROUP”,一直点“下一步”,直到问“你要做什么?”时,会出现四个选项,选择第四项,“完成该向导”就可以了。 打开笔记本电脑上的IE,是不是可以上网了设计5:利用ADSL实现共享上网。 设计6:利用代理服务器实现共享上网。 设计7:简单FTP客户端软件设计。 设计8:RS-232串行接口通信软件设计